beat4life CPR We are passionate about teaching CPR to all ages throughout the Washington DC, Metropolitan area.

If you are interested in learning CPR for yourself, your family, or in obtaining certification for your workplace, welcome — you will find help here. We are registered nurses who are passionate about teaching CPR to people ranging from children to adults, from medical professionals to people with no healthcare experience. We are CPR instructors with experience teaching in a wide variety of settings throughout the Washington, D.C., metropolitan region. Our aim is to provide flexible and expert training whether you are an expectant or experienced parent, teacher, coach, or someone needing certification or recertification for work. Please see our testimonials tab (page) to learn about our impact and see how we might help you. As founders of Beat4LifeCPR, we are dedicated to teaching CPR and AED skills in a supportive and comfortable environment. Our ultimate goal is to empower each client to save lives whenever faced with situations where CPR/AED use is necessary. We strive to ensure that every person taking our classes feels confident about using these lifesaving skills after spending time training with us.

There are three spots remaining for our Safe Sitter Class this Sat- June 3, 2023. We are hosting the class at Sibley Hospital in NW D.C. Follow this link to register.

Safe Sitter® prepares students in grades 6-8 to be safe when they’re home alone, watching younger siblings, or babysitting.
